S.AMDT.356
Amends: H.R.1268
Sponsor: Sen Durbin, Richard [IL] (submitted 4/12/2005) (proposed 4/12/2005)
AMENDMENT PURPOSE:
To ensure that a Federal employee who takes leave without pay in order to perform service as a member of the uniformed services or member of the National Guard shall continue to receive pay in an amount which when taken together with the pay and allowances such individual is receiving for such service, will be no less than the basic pay such individual would then be receiving if no interruption in employment had occurred.
TEXT OF AMENDMENT AS SUBMITTED: CR S3500
STATUS:
- 4/12/2005:
- Amendment SA 356 proposed by Senator Durbin. (consideration: CR S3470-3473; text: CR S3470)
- 4/13/2005:
- Considered by Senate. (consideration: CR S3509, S3513, S3518-3520)
- 4/13/2005:
- Motion to table amendment SA 356 rejected in Senate by Yea-Nay Vote. 39 - 61. Record Vote Number: 91.
- 4/13/2005:
- Amendment SA 356 agreed to in Senate by Voice Vote.
